Case Study: Verifone cuts API management TCO 75% with Kong Gateway
Key results
The challenge
Verifone set out to build a unified global omnichannel payments solution spanning in-store and e-commerce operations across more than 150 countries with varying regional regulations. It had previously operated around 20 separate regional monolithic systems, each with its own API documentation standards, which added cost and complexity.
The solution
Verifone migrated to a microservices architecture with Kong Gateway Enterprise as a centralized abstraction layer to expose APIs across regions, apply authentication and rate-limiting policies, and standardize API documentation using OpenAPI. The gateway supports hybrid, multi-cloud, and on-premise deployments.

The results, in context
According to Kong's published case study, Verifone reduced the total cost of ownership of its API management by 75%. The company also reported that its development teams saved hundreds of hours per month through automated generation and maintenance of API contracts with OpenAPI and centralized monitoring of API traffic.
